This Certificate Programme in German for Healthcare Professionals is designed to equip healthcare workers with the language skills necessary for effective communication in German-speaking healthcare settings. The programme focuses on practical application, ensuring students gain confidence in real-world scenarios.
Learning outcomes include fluency in medical German terminology, comprehension of patient information, and the ability to confidently participate in medical discussions. Participants will improve their reading, writing, listening, and speaking skills, crucial for successful integration into the international healthcare field.
